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Having 18-35 years old Being on 16-28 weeks of gestation Singleton Pregnancy Having the ability to read and write

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Having clinical and obstetric problems Having acute psychiatric disorders Having cigarettes or alcohol addictions or drugs abuse Having history of abnormal stressful conditions due to unpleasant life events such as death of husband or other family members, divorce, huffing with husband, and being of husband on prison

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Maternal-fetal attachment. Timepoint: Before and immediately at the end of intervention. Method of measurement: The Maternal-Foetal Attachment Scale.
